WebCYA, also known as “stabilizer” or “conditioner” in the pool industry, protects chlorine from degradation from the ultraviolet (UV) rays of the sun. CYA can be very beneficial up to a point, but becomes increasingly detrimental to the pool beyond that. WebCyanuric acid is often called chlorine stabilizer because it quite literally stabilizes the bonds between the hydrogen, oxygen, and chlorine atoms of hypochlorous acid and hypochlorite ions that would break down due to the overwhelming energy of UV light from the sun.
